Re: c++0x: libraries and features


David Vandevoorde wrote:

Yes, that was also my impression: it's "almost resolved", though there wasn't closure (ouch :-P).


My last e-mail in that thread claimed that nonlocal lambda's didn't require an ABI-mandated mangling. I'd like some experienced voice to confirm/deny that claim.

Earlier, I made a proposal for mangling local lambda's that I think is okay, but I haven't sent a patch to Mark M. yet. Here is a relevant quote

On Dec 17, 2008, at 10:39 AM, John Freeman wrote:

Doug Gregor wrote:

We need something that encodes the context of the lambda (function "::foo" with no parameters) followed by, perhaps, a numbering scheme within that context. The context encoding needs to account for (at least) inline functions, classes, and namespaces.


This sounds like a problem that must have been encountered before. Is there already a solution for it? At least for the unnumbered portion?


Yes, see 5.1.6. We can reuse that general scheme for local lambdas. E.g.:

<local-lambda-name> := Z <function encoding> E l [<discriminator>]

and maybe introduce something similar for local unnamed classes:

<local-unnamed-class_name> := Z <function encoding> E u [<discriminator>]


I believe this is another relevant quote (amended by myself):


In a default argument, we could mangle it as if it's part of the
entity where the default argument lives (in a function or template).


I believe it would require a different [discriminator] from the entities local to that function/template, though (since the the two might not coexist in the same translation unit).


Ah, right. So we need to have a separate mangling scheme and [discriminator] for the default arguments and for the entities local to that function/template.
